The Argentina national team continued its tradition - if they make it to the semi-finals of the World Cup, they will certainly win it.

World Cup 2022

Argentina - Croatia 3:0 (2:0)
Goals: Messi, 34 (penalty) (1:0); Álvarez Jul., 39 (2:0); Álvarez Jul., 69 (3:0)

Argentina: Martinez E.; Molina N. (Angel Correa, 86); Otamendi; Romero C.; Tagliafico; Fernandez E.; Paredes L. (Martínez Li., 62); Mac Allister A. (Foyth, 86); De Paul (Palacios Ex., 74); Messi; Álvarez Jul. (Dybala, 74)
Bench: Almada; Rulli; Armani; Pezzella G.; Rodríguez G.; Di Maria; Martínez L.
Yellow Cards: Romero C. 68; Otamendi 71

Croatia: Livaković; Gvardiol; Sosa B. (Oršić, 46); Lovren; Juranovic; Kovacic M.; Modric (Majer L., 81); Pasalic (Vlasic, 46); Perišić I.; Brozovic (Petković B., 50); Kramaric (Livaja, 72)
Bench: Ivusic; Grbić; Sutalo J.; Stanisic; Erlic; Vida; Barišić B.; Jakic; Sucic; Budimir
Yellow Cards: Livaković 32; Kovacic M. 32
